For the cookies:
- 2 ½ cups quick oats
- ½ cup unsalted butter
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- ½ cup milk
- 1 Tbsp lemon zest (from about 1 lemon)
- 2 Tbsp fresh lemon juice
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- Pinch of salt
For the lemon glaze:
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 2–3 Tbsp fresh lemon juice
- ½ tsp lemon zest
Instructions
- Prepare a baking sheet: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one mat.
- Cook the wet ingredients: In a medium sa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ter, then stir in the sugar, milk, and lemon zest. Bring to a gentle boil and let it cook for 1-2 minutes while stirring.
- Mix in the oats: Remove from heat and stir in the oats, lemon juice,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t. Mix well until everything is combined.
- Form the cookies: Scoop about 1 ½ tablespoons of the mixture onto the prepared baking sheet, shaping them into flat cookies. Let them set at room temperature for 30-45 minutes or until firm.
- Make the glaze: In a small bowl, whisk together powdered sugar, lemon juice, and zest until smooth.
- Glaze & Set: Drizzle or dip the cookies in the lemon glaze and allow them to set for 15 minutes until the glaze hardens.
Notes
- If you want a stronger lemon flavor, feel free to add extra lemon zest to the glaze.
- Make sure the cookies are fully set before serving for the best texture.
- These cookies can be stored in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
